Ingredients for Your Chinese Salad
To create a robust Chinese salad, you will need the following ingredients:
- 4 cups of mixed salad greens (such as romaine, spinach, and cabbage)
- 1 cup shredded carrots
- 1 cup bell peppers, sliced (mix colors for a vibrant look)
- 1 cup snap peas or snow peas
- 1 cup cooked chicken breast (or tofu for a vegetarian option)
- 1/2 cup green onions, sliced
- 1/2 cup Mandarin oranges (canned or fresh)
- 1/4 cup sesame seeds
- 1/4 cup chopped cilantro (optional)
Instructions to Prepare the Salad
Follow these steps to prepare your meal-prep-friendly Chinese salad:
- Wash and Chop: Thoroughly wash and dry the salad greens and all vegetables. Chop them into bite-sized pieces, making it easier to mix and eat later.
- Cook the Protein: If you haven't already, cook your chicken breast or tofu. Season lightly with salt and pepper, then slice or cube it into bite-sized pieces.
- Mix the Salad: In a large bowl, combine the salad greens, shredded carrots, bell peppers, snap peas, chicken or tofu, green onions, Mandarin oranges, and sesame seeds. Toss everything together gently until well mixed.
Make the Dressing
A delicious dressing can elevate your salad to new heights. Here’s a simple recipe for a homemade sesame ginger dressing:
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 1/4 cup rice vinegar
- 2 tablespoons sesame oil
- 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up
- 1 tablespoon freshly grated ginger
- 1 garlic clove, minced
Combine all the dressing ingredients in a jar or bowl and shake or whisk until well combined. Adjust the quantities to suit your taste.
Assemble and Store
To ensure freshness, it’s best to store your salad in individual containers. Follow these steps:
- Place a layer of dressing at the bottom of each container.
- Add your salad mixture on top of the dressing, ensuring that the ingredients remain crisp and fresh.
- Seal the containers tightly and refrigerate. This salad is best enjoyed within five days.
Enjoying Your Meal Prep Chinese Salad
When it’s time to eat, simply shake the container to mix the dressing with your salad ingredients. This Chinese salad makes for a refreshing lunch at the office or a light dinner at home.
Feel free to customize the salad by adding other ingredients such as sliced almonds, crispy wontons, or your favorite protein. This versatility makes it easy to keep your meals exciting throughout the week.
